For consumers, chocolate chip cookies and doughnuts are substitutes. So, an increase in the price of chocolate chip cookies will lead to a rightward shift in the demand curve for doughnuts.
Accounts Receivable
Liabilities of customers to a business entity for services or products provided but still awaiting payment.
Bad Debts Expense
An estimated expense that represents accounts receivable that a company does not expect to collect.
Normal Balance
Normal balance refers to the side of the accounting equation on which increases to an account are recorded, which is debits for asset and expense accounts, and credits for liability, equity, and revenue accounts.
Allowance for Doubtful Accounts
An account that offsets assets, designed to predict the amount of a company’s accounts receivable that is likely to be uncollectible.
